Course Objectives: The objective of this course is focusing on video production formats and learning video assisting

Learning Outcomes

The students who have succeeded in this course;
The students who have succeeded in this course;
1) Analyse different camera techniques
2) Be working on camera, shooting and lighting techniques in detail
3) Be able to work on and observe production processes
4) Be working on sound, editing and continuity in film production
5) Be learning production and postproduction of a short film or video

Course Content

Producing videos focusing on video assist techniques, digital film cameras, sound, editing and production techniques in detail. This course is a practical course focusing on technical production processes.
